Ask AgentOccupying a generous plot at the end of a quiet private cul-de-sac in the highly sought-after village of Thringstone, this beautifully presented detached home offers spacious and versatile accommodation throughout. Boasting three generous double bedrooms, all benefiting from their own en-suite facilities, the property is ideal for modern family living or those seeking flexible guest accommodation. The ground floor features a welcoming entrance hall, lounge, dining room, WC, and a double bedroom with en-suite shower room, while the first floor offers two further double bedrooms with en-suite bathroom and shower room respectively. Externally, the property enjoys a beautifully maintained rear garden with a peaceful outlook, a large driveway providing parking for multiple vehicles, and an integral double garage.
